Immerse yourself in the rich tapestry of North Indian classical music with Lakshmi Shankar's captivating album, "Inde du Nord - North India: Season and Time / Les heures et les saisons." Released on September 20, 2011, under the Ocora Radio-France label, this album is a mesmerizing journey through traditional Indian ragas and devotional bhajans.
Lakshmi Shankar, a renowned artist in the world of Indian classical music, brings her unique voice and profound understanding of the genre to this 57-minute collection. The album features a diverse range of compositions, including Khyal in Raga Ahir Bhairav and Dhani, Bhajans in Raga Megh and Bhairavi, and a Qawwali-inspired piece in Raga Khafi. Each track is a testament to Shankar's mastery of the art form, showcasing her ability to evoke deep emotions and spiritual resonance through her music.
The album's title, "Season and Time," reflects the cyclical nature of Indian classical music, where ragas are often associated with specific times of the day or seasons. From the slow, meditative Vilambit Khyal in Raga Ahir Bhairav to the lively Drut Khyal in Tala Ektal, each piece offers a unique perspective on the passage of time and the changing seasons.
